We are seeking a proven leader to play a pivotal role in driving product innovation and delivery. By aligning business strategy with user experience and technology, the Portfolio Manager leads the discovery, research, design, and implementation of impactful solutions. Operating in an Agile environment, the Portfolio Manager supports Product Owners, manages the program backlog, and fosters continuous delivery across teams to ensure strategic outcomes are achieved. The ideal candidate has five or more years of experience in IT, business, or software project management and brings advanced knowledge of products, systems, and industry operations, – particularly within the Property & Casualty and Commercial Lines insurance – along with strong leadership and collaboration skills.
